Preconditioning Of Morphine Long-term Protection On Rabbit Ischemic Hindlimb Muscle

Objective:To investigate whether Preconditioning of morphine can accomplish a long protection on rabbit ischemic hindlimb muscle the same as the IPC.Methods:Thirty healthy New Zealand White rabbits were randomly divided into3groups:①IPC group(n=8):Right hind accepted5-minute ischemia and5-reperfusion3cycles, then reocclude the femoral artery forever after24hours.③physiological saline group(n=8):eight White rabbits were pretreated with physiological saline (3mg/kg) through ear vein, the same operation afer24hours. Immunohistochemistry was used to detect Angiogenesis of ischemic issue taken from the gastrocnemius by the Light microscope after3days, and Masson staining Infarct size.Results:1.CD31staining positive cells can be observed in Morphine groups, and its cell counting was significantly smaller than saline pretreatment groups and Greater than the IPC pretreatment groups,2. Collagen fibers staining can be observed in each groups,and In Morphine groups, its infarct size was significantly smaller than saline pretreatment groups and Greater than the IPC pretreatment groups.Conclusion:The results of morphine preconditioning showed that Morphine preconditioning differed from IP conditioning in statistics(P<0.05), but it actually had ability to promote the regeneration of ischemic areas of microvascular similar to IP conditioning.
